Tigerwalk Espresso is built around a coffee grown by members of Cooperativa de Caficultores del Cauca in partnership with the FederaciĂ³n Nacional de Cafeteros de Colombia (FNC), an organization that promotes the production and exportation of Colombian coffee. Located in Southwest Colombia, Cauca coffee is known for its smooth chocolate-toned flavors which act as the foundation of this espresso blend.
We then add a fully washed coffee from Kenya that adds elements of brightness and fruit flavors. Kenya’s system is one of the best in the world for compensating high quality lots; after tasting the coffees, registered buyers compete at auctions where the best lots fetch higher prices. These
auctions are small, so our partners must purchase many lots of similar quality and blend them together through a complex grading system to create the flavor profile we need for our blend.
Finally, a natural processed coffee grown in the Bombe Mountains of Southern Ethiopia rounds out the blend. Bombe’s high altitude stresses the coffee tree, and the colder climate slows the growth cycle. The result is a slowly matured cherry that is small, dense, and packed with flavor. After harvesting, natural processed coffee is dried with the coffee cherry fully intact, imparting distinct fruit-forward flavors into the coffee. Together, these three coffees create a well-balanced, creamy espresso with a broad range of delicate fruit flavors.

Our flagship espresso is roasted to highlight sweet, fruit-forward flavors found in the component coffees. The coffee spends more time in the roaster to coax these flavors out and tamp down the acidity, yielding a balanced and versatile espresso. We enjoy this coffee so much that we serve it at all of our cafes!
While there are many variables that contribute to dialing in espresso, here are the parameters that have been yielding the best results in our lab:
1:2.2 coffee to water ratio in 27 seconds.
